Question: In a welding joint symbol, what does the 'tail' typically represent?

Answer options: ✅ Supplementary information or special instructions

  • The type of weld geometry
  • The size of the weld
  • The welding process to be used

Correct answer: Supplementary information or special instructions

Explanation: The tail of a welding symbol is used to convey supplementary information, such as the welding process, filler metal specification, or other specific instructions not contained in the main symbol.
